I have a client with w2k (IE 6) and a Windows 2003 server (with IIS 6.0).
I would like to setup IIS 6.0 to authenticate the users trying to access
to a web page. I'd like to use kerberos v5.

During the IIS setup, I enabled "Integrated Windows authentification".

But each time I go to this page, I'm authenticated with the NTML
protocol and not kerberos.
I thought that the default protocol used for this kind of auth. was
kerberos.
I don't know what is wrong with this setup.

Do you have some ideas?

Thanks for your reply, I just found my mistake, I put them on the same
domain and enabled the windows integrated auth. in IE.
Now it works fine.
